Maine Kids Will Publish a Book With Help from Stephen King

According to good ol Wikipedia, his books have sold over 350 million copies. He was born in Portland, raised in Scarborough and Durham, Maine, and studied at the University of Maine in Orono. I blame King for the majority of my nightmares as a child. My older brother suggested I join him for a showing of The Shining at the ripe age of six. I don t think I ve ever been right since. According to Boston.com, a group of young writers at Farwell Elementary School in Lewiston, Maine, are following in King s footsteps. The site states their story Fletcher McKenzie and the Passage to Whole,” is about a boy from Maine. The 290-page manuscript is described as pandemic inspired .

State Lunch Hosting Virtual Valentine s Sweetheart Dinner

Looking for a way to support local businesses while you enjoy a nice dinner and show with your special someone? Valentine s Day is coming up, and State Lunch is offering a pretty delicious deal that would be the perfect match! According to the State Lunch Facebook page, they re hosting their first fundraiser of 2021, and all proceeds will be going directly to the historical Colonial theater. On Valentine s Day, State Lunch will be offering a virtual 3-course Sweatheart dinner and a virtual performance by Maine-based singer/songwriter Pete Kilpatrick. Dinners must be picked up between 10 am and 2 pm, on Sunday, February 14th at State Lunch located at 217 Water Street in Augusta.
